Biography
Drawing from diverse musical influences, HogMaw creates a sound that is based on tradition but is beyond bluegrass, often described as Progressive or NewGrass. Playing in support of their first self-titled release, HogMaw's live performances are a blend of rowdy and rompin' music rooted in bluegrass tradition while at the same time pushing boundaries with edgy melodic riffs and catchy choruses.
Recently, HogMaw was a featured band on WXPN's Folk Show with Gene Shay, and can be heard on many radio stations in Pennsylvania, New Jersey, Delaware and Maryland. To date, HogMaw has performed at many notable venues and festivals such as: Delfest in Cumberland, MD; American Music Festival in Harrisburg, PA; Camp Jam in the Pines in Monroeville, NJ; The North Star Bar and Tin Angel in Philadelphia, PA; Bube's Brewery in Mount Joy, PA; and at Sovereign Bank Stadium in York, PA where HogMaw won the 2009 York Revolution Battle of the Bands and performed a concert for over 7,000 Revs fans.
